Ep 74. Route Density 101 The Scoop With Erica Krupin

    • Entrepreneurship

Join host Erica Krupin on this insightful episode of The Scoop Podcast, where she delves into the essential aspects of routing density that every entrepreneur in the poop scooping business should know. Drawing from her own experiences, Erica shares invaluable tips and lessons learned that she wishes she knew when she first started her business.
 
Understanding the demographics of the areas you'll be servicing is crucial, from income levels to population density and even crime rates. But how do you use this information to optimize your routes and maximize efficiency?
 
Erica tackles common dilemmas faced by business owners, such as whether to assign customers a specific scoop day or allow them to choose. She also dives into the intricacies of route creation and the importance of maintaining boundaries, especially when it comes to accommodating customer requests that may disrupt your carefully planned schedule.
 
In this episode, Erica emphasizes the significance of route density and its impact on your bottom line. She shares eye-opening insights into the realities of driving during peak hours and offers practical advice for staying ahead of scheduling challenges, particularly during the springtime when landscapers vie for attention.
 
Discover why it's essential to play the long game in building your customer base and how marketing within specific areas can establish your authority in the field. Erica also sheds light on the role of tools like Jobber in streamlining operations and discusses the unique considerations for integrating such software into a poop scooping business.
 
Whether you're just starting out or looking to optimize your existing operations, this episode is a must-listen for any entrepreneur navigating the world of poop scooping. Tune in and learn how to take control of your routing, market strategically, and build a thriving business with route density at its core.
